The cell - membrane has a phospholipid bilayer structure. The hydrophilic heads of phospholipids face the aqueous environments (inside and outside the cell), and the hydrophobic tails face each other in the interior of the bilayer. In a correct representation, the heads should be on the outer and inner surfaces of the membrane, and the tails should be in the middle.
